Mohammad Shafi Bhat, noted political activist and close associate of Abdul Gani Lone, passes away

Convener News Desk

Bandipora, Feb 02: Mohammad Shafi Bhat, a known political activist from Plan Bandipora, passed away on Monday after a brief illness, family sources said.

Bhat was a long-time associate of the late Abdul Gani Lone and was widely recognised for his service to the community through his work as a teachers and later a petition writer in local courts.

He was a close associate of Abdul Gani Lone and has actively been associated with Jammu and Kashmir People’s Conference since many decades. Known for his humility, integrity and dedication, he was respected for guiding and assisting people with patience and compassion.

The Namaz-e-Janaza was offered at 11:00 a.m., led by Imam-e-Hai Bandipora, Moulana Khursheed Anwar Naqshbandi. A large number of people from all walks of life attended the funeral prayers, paying their respects to the deceased.

Jammu and Kashmir Peoples Conference (JKPC) chief Sajad Lone expressed grief over Bhat’s demise in a tweet, describing him as a close associate of both his father and himself. He recalled sharing “some of my best times and memories” with Bhat and prayed for his soul, saying, “May Allah grant him Jannatul Firdaus and give patience and strength to the entire family. Ameen.”

Family members and local residents remembered Bhat for his moral uprightness, gentle demeanor, and contributions to the welfare of the community, which left an indelible impression on those who knew him.
